Mission Statement

Mount Mercy College is a Catholic college providing student-focused baccalaureate education in the spirit of the Sisters of Mercy. As a Catholic college founded and sponsored by the Sisters of Mercy, Mount Mercy College welcomes women and men of all beliefs to join our community in the pursuit of baccalaureate education and service to those in need. Mount Mercy College promotes reflective judgment, strategic communication, the common good and purposeful living through a core curriculum, liberal arts and professional majors and student development programs.
